Transaction 853177671b3ca4b4eee304a7da15e39a7161add40ff052ee8de4b300f88b4482

1 Input
2 Outputs
  • 853177671b3ca4b4eee304a7da15e39a7161add40ff052ee8de4b300f88b4482:0
  • value  2189181
    address  3AfdFC2bWM7DqjdnCYfA5ru6171qSG5yTx
  • 853177671b3ca4b4eee304a7da15e39a7161add40ff052ee8de4b300f88b4482:1
  • value  235224
    address  12chAyxPykfx1wC6EJgudgvGfYGrDh2uUi